Circuit Breakers

Circuit breakers are essential electrical safety devices that protect electrical circuits from damage caused by overcurrent conditions, such as short circuits or overloads. They function by interrupting the flow of electricity when the current exceeds a safe threshold, preventing potential fires and damage to electrical equipment.

Definition:
A circuit breaker is an automatically operated electrical switch designed to protect an electrical circuit from damage due to excess current from an overload or a short circuit. Its basic function is to cut off the flow of current when it reaches a predetermined level, which is dangerous.

Function:
1. Overcurrent Protection: Circuit breakers trip or "break" the circuit when the current exceeds the breaker's rating, preventing potential damage.
2. Safety: They provide a means of safely disconnecting the circuit for maintenance or in case of an emergency.
3. Automatic Reset: Many circuit breakers are designed to automatically reset once the overcurrent condition is removed.

Applications:
1. Residential: In homes, circuit breakers are used in the electrical panel to protect individual circuits, such as those for lighting, appliances, and outlets.
2. Commercial: In commercial buildings, they protect larger circuits and equipment, ensuring the safety of the electrical system.
3. Industrial: In industrial settings, circuit breakers are critical for protecting machinery and equipment from electrical faults.
4. Power Distribution: They are used in power distribution systems to prevent overloads and short circuits that could disrupt service.

Selection Criteria:
1. Current Rating: Choose a breaker with a current rating that matches the load it will protect.
2. Voltage Rating: Ensure the breaker is rated for the voltage of the circuit it will be used in.
3. Type of Circuit: Different types of breakers are designed for different applications, such as residential, commercial, or industrial use.
4. Certifications: Look for breakers that meet safety standards and certifications relevant to your region.
5. Size and Space: Consider the physical size of the breaker and the space available in the electrical panel.
6. Cost: While cost is a factor, prioritizing safety and reliability over price is crucial.

In summary, circuit breakers are vital for maintaining the integrity and safety of electrical systems. They are selected based on the specific requirements of the circuit they are designed to protect, ensuring that they can effectively manage and interrupt current flow when necessary.
